Frequently Asked Questions
Servicing Your Interest Ownership
Clearing the Title

If oil and gas can be produced in commercial quantities, interest owners are responsible for clearing title to the oil, gas and mineral interest ownership for production on the property.

Receiving a Division Order

After a title is cleared, Division Orders will be issued to the interest owners for signature. The Division Order includes the name of each interest owner, the decimal interest for each interest owner, a legal description of the property, and the operator's name. When this procedure is completed, revenue payments will begin.

Receiving a Transfer Order

When an ownership is being transferred between parties, Transfer Orders will be issued to each party for signature. The Transfer Order includes the name of each interest owner, the decimal interest for each interest owner, a legal description of the property, and the operator's name. A W-9 may also be required from the new interest owner. When this procedure is complete, revenue payments will begin.

Change in Ownership

Changes in ownership are common during the life of the well. Written documentation is required for any change in ownership. For example:

  • Transfer of assignment of interest to another party

  • Change in marital status

  • Death of an interest owner

  • Changes to a decimal interest

  • Changes in property boundaries or description

Revenue Payments
Taxpayer Identification Number
Federal Law requires that each interest owner provide a taxpayer identification number (TIN) for the owner account. For most individuals, the TIN in your social security number. For other owners, the TIN is the employer identification number. Failure to provide the appropriate TIN could result in 28 percent being withheld from your revenue checks for federal income taxes.
Suspended Revenue Payments

Occasionally revenue payments are suspended for the interest owner's protection. Some examples of when suspension might occur are:

  • When we do not have your current mailing address

  • When the title to your interest is disputed or in question

  • When an assignment or transfer of your interest is pending

  • Upon notification of the death of an interest owner

Other Frequently Asked Questions
What is a Division Order

A Division Order is a document signed by the interest owner verifying to the purchaser or operator of a well the decimal interest for that owner. It also requires the interest owner to provide the owner's correct mailing address and tax identification number.

What is a Transfer Order

A transfer order is a document signed by each party involved in a transfer of interest ownership that verifies the transfer. The same information is required as for a Division Order.

How Do I Transfer My Interest in a Well?

A deed or assignment must be prepared to transfer your interest. You may wish to consult with an attorney for preparation of this document. A recorded copy of that conveyance must be provided to our offices.

What Happens if I Change My Mailing Address or Marital Status?

Address changes must be provided to us in writing by letter or email for your protection. You should include your name, old address, new address, owner number, tax identification number and signature. For changes in marital status, a copy of your marriage license or certificate must be provided.

What Happens When An Interest Owner Dies?
Once Wold Oil Properties, Inc. has been notified that an interest owner is deceased, those interests are suspended pending receipt of proper documentation of the interest owner's death and identification of the proper heirs. Such documentation might include a death certificate, will, or other documents relating to the interest owner's estate.
What is the Difference Between a Royalty Owner and an Interest Owner?
A royalty owner shares in production revenue while a working interest owner share in production revenue, development and operating expenses on the well.

Why Are My Monthly Payments Sometimes Different?
Many variables affect your monthly revenue payments such as market prices for oil and gas, diminished production as well as weather conditions.
Why Is My Monthly Payment Different From Other Family Members?
Sometimes ownership interest between family members is not equal or some family members may have ownership interests in other wells for which they receive production revenue.

How Do I Clear the Title to My Oil and Gas Interests?

When a well is first drilled, an attorney will prepare a title opinion of the ownership of the well based on a thorough search of the county records. If there is a question regarding ownership of title, the attorney will notify the operator with the requirement needs to clear the title question. The operator will, in turn, notify the interest owner of the problem and suggested resolution. At that point, it is up to the interest owner to clear the title and provide proof to the operator.

When Are Revenue Payments Suspended?

For the protection of the interest owner, revenue payments are suspended when there is a title dispute, the interest being assigned or transferred to another party, the interest owner is deceased, or no current mailing address is available for the interest owner. It is the responsibility of the interest owner to notify the operator and / or purchaser of any changes in ownership, address or marital status.
